I started blogging in 2005. I wrote anything under the sun, but mostly about my experiences as a young pro in BPO land, my love-hate relationship with watching Philippine Idol (yes, the original ABC-5 incarnation of the international singing competition) and movie reviews (ligwakan galore). When I entered film school in late 2006 and had that feeling I want to make films in the future, I decided to quit the film reviews. Suddenly, it felt weird praising and butchering other films, then posting my views for everyone to see. (Really, it felt like kissing asses of filmmakers that I like or turning myself into a moving target of the makers of film I turned into snoozefest). So I stuck to sharing about my worldviews. Back then, Friendster and Multiply were the hip sites, and we share links via email or Yahoo Messenger. These weren’t as powerful as Facebook and other social media that we enjoy today. See, I had a blog but I did not really intend to turn my life and thoughts into an open book...
